CREATION OF WHEAT CULTIVAR SIBIRSKAYA 21 ADAPTED TO THE WESTERN SIBERIA CONDITIONS

Abstract

The paper presents biological, economic and technological characteristics of the new spring common wheat cultivar Sibirskaya 21. Breeding work on the creation of the cultivar was carried out in Novosibirsk region on chernozem soils of the forest-steppe zone in 2004-2012 preceded by bare fallow. Observations and studies were carried out according to the conventional methods in comparative analysis with the standard cultivar Novosibirskaya 31. Cultivar Sibirskaya 21 was created by a single individual selection from a hybrid population (Novosibirskaya 67 × Udacha) × Sibirskaya 17, obtained as a result of intraspecific hybridization by the Tvel method and the estimation of recombinants in yield, intensity of plant productivity elements, flour-baking qualities of grain and resistance to the fungal pathogens on a provocative background to artificial infection. Cultivar Sibirskaya 21 is a variety of Lutescens. It is a mid-early cultivar, with the growing period of 72-82 days. Plant height is 95-105 cm. The average yield in fallow over the years of competitive variety testing amounted to 3.27 t/ha, which is 0.57 t/ha higher than the standard. The maximum yield was 6 t/ha. The cultivar is characterized by high drought resistance. In the highly arid year 2012, the yield was 1.97 t/ha, which is higher than the standard by 0.59 t/ha. Baking qualities of grain are average. The weight of 1000 grains is 29.0-37.0 g. The nature of the grain is 750-800 g/l. The content of crude gluten is 28.0 – 36.0%. The volume output of bread is 500-640 cm3/100 g. The total baking score is 3.7-4.2 points. The cultivar is resistant to covered and loose smut, slightly susceptible to powdery mildew, and moderately susceptible to leaf brown rust. The cultivar is included in the State Register of Breeding Achievements for the West Siberian region. It is recommended for cultivation in different areas of the Altai territory, Novosibirsk and Omsk regions.
